Sobre The Stories of Canada's Frontier: Stories and Adventure of the Indians, Missionaries, Fur-Traders & Settlers of Western Canada
On Canada's Frontier is an autobiographical sketch by Julian Ralph. The book is based on author's experiences from his journeys to West Canada. This book is composed of series of papers which recorded journeys and studies author made in Canada during the three years he stayed there. The author brings many interesting stories of adventures of Indigenous people of Canada, missionaries, fur-traders, and settlers to this theritory.
